Armez-vous de vos sortilèges et de votre courage pour eliminer tous vos ennemis avant qu’ils ne le fassent
À propos de Lich Survivors (2023)
« Vampire Survivors Like », Action, Bullet Hell, Survival
Lich Survivors est un prototype de « Vampire Survivors Like » réalisé en 3d sur Unreal Engine 5.
Vous incarnez Tssorafelt, un nécromancien du culte de l’araignée armé de son sceptre arcanique et de différents sortilèges uniques, vous devrez contenir les hordes envoyées par les vindicateurs de l’ordre saint d’Arandir. Pour se faire, vous aurez accès à des capacités déblocables telles que l’invocation d’araignées empoisonnées, ou la pluie de météores. Utilisez-les à bon escient pour survivre jusqu’au bout.
J’ai développé ce jeu entièrement seul dans le cadre de mes études en tant que première production réalisée sur le moteur Unreal Engine 5.
Features
• Controller Top Down
• Jeu bullet hell avec flots constants d’ennemis de plus en plus nombreux à éliminer.
• Nombreux sorts à débloquer et à améliorer octroyant des aptitudes toujours plus puissantes et explosives.
J’ai développé ce jeu seul, et je me suis donc chargé de toute la conception, le développement et l’intégration du projet sur Unreal Engine 5 (à l’exception des assets graphiques et audios que je n’ai pas créé moi-même, mais uniquement personnalisés et intégrés depuis différentes banques d’assets) :
Conception et implémentation des systèmes de jeu sur Unreal Engine 5 :
Développement du core gameplay du jeu, création du système de vagues d’ennemis jusqu’à la fin du temps de jeu défini.
Character Controller en vue top down contrôlable au clavier ou à la souris avec pathfinding intégré.
Développement et implémentation du système de sorts déblocables et améliorables par le joueur au cours de la partie, chacun avec ses effets propres (projectile enflamme auto-guidé, projectiles de glace en ligne droite, ralentissement temporaire du temps, invocation d’araignées venimeuses, chutes de météorites, etc…).
Mécanique d’Upgrades des capacités actives mais aussi passives du joueur (vitesse de déplacement, points de vie etc…) à la manière d’un « Vampire Survivors » offrant la possibilité au joueur de débloquer ou améliorer ses aptitudes parmi une sélection de 3 améliorations possibles choisies aléatoirement à chaque niveau qu’il obtient, après avoir terrassé suffisamment d’ennemis et récupéré leurs cristaux d’expérience.
Intégration de l’ensemble des effets visuels, sonores, et animations.
Développement des IA :
Comportement des ennemis suivant le joueur et l’attaquant dès qu’il est à leur portée.
Logique des créatures invoquées par le joueur qui le soutiennent et attaquent automatiquement les ennemis les plus proches d’elles tant qu’elles survivent.
Conception et mise en place de l’ensemble des interfaces utilisateur (UI) et menus.
Mise en place et gestion du versionning via Git.
Optimisation globale des performances, notamment sur la qualité graphique.
Gérer le consentement
Pour offrir les meilleures expériences, nous utilisons des technologies telles que les cookies pour stocker et/ou accéder aux informations des appareils. Le fait de consentir à ces technologies nous permettra de traiter des données telles que le comportement de navigation ou les ID uniques sur ce site. Le fait de ne pas consentir ou de retirer son consentement peut avoir un effet négatif sur certaines caractéristiques et fonctions.
Fonctionnel
Toujours activé
L’accès ou le stockage technique est strictement nécessaire dans la finalité d’intérêt légitime de permettre l’utilisation d’un service spécifique explicitement demandé par l’abonné ou l’utilisateur, ou dans le seul but d’effectuer la transmission d’une communication sur un réseau de communications électroniques.
Préférences
L’accès ou le stockage technique est nécessaire dans la finalité d’intérêt légitime de stocker des préférences qui ne sont pas demandées par l’abonné ou l’internaute.
Statistiques
Le stockage ou l’accès technique qui est utilisé exclusivement à des fins statistiques.Le stockage ou l’accès technique qui est utilisé exclusivement dans des finalités statistiques anonymes. En l’absence d’une assignation à comparaître, d’une conformité volontaire de la part de votre fournisseur d’accès à internet ou d’enregistrements supplémentaires provenant d’une tierce partie, les informations stockées ou extraites à cette seule fin ne peuvent généralement pas être utilisées pour vous identifier.
Marketing
L’accès ou le stockage technique est nécessaire pour créer des profils d’internautes afin d’envoyer des publicités, ou pour suivre l’utilisateur sur un site web ou sur plusieurs sites web ayant des finalités marketing similaires.